What companies run services between Ivrea, Italy and Messina, Italy?

You can take a bus from Ivrea - Via Circonvallazione, 40 - Porta Vercelli to Messina Main Train Station via Fermata 8320 - ROMOLO E REMO EST and Turin Stura Bus Station in around 23h 10m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Ivrea to Messina Centrale via Torino Porta Nuova in around 20h 34m.
